What Are CS2 Cases?
CS2 cases are virtual containers that hold randomized weapon skins and items. These cases were introduced as a method to disperse cosmetic products across the player base, developing a vibrant marketplace where skins can be traded, offered, or collected. Each case includes products of differing rarity, from common consumer-grade skins to incredibly uncommon unique products that can be worth substantial quantities of cash.
The thrill of opening a case lies in the element of surprise. Gamers never know precisely what they'll get until the case is opened with a corresponding secret, making each opening an amazing moment.
How Do CS2 Cases Work?
The mechanics behind CS2 cases are simple yet interesting. Players acquire cases through various means, including gameplay rewards, buying from the Steam Community Market, or getting them as gifts. Each case requires a specific key to open, which can be acquired straight through Steam or from third-party markets.
When a gamer opens a case, the game carries out a randomized choice based on fixed rarity weights. The system "rolls" to determine which item rarity will be acquired, and then picks a specific skin from that rarity tier. Higher-rarity items have significantly lower drop rates, which describes why unusual skins command premium rates.

The CS2 Case Market Economy
The case opening system has actually produced a significant economy around CS2 skins. Numerous gamers treat case opening as a kind of home entertainment, comparable to trading cards or loot boxes. Others view it as a financial investment opportunity, acquiring cases and secrets in bulk wishing to get rare products worth significantly more than their initial investment.
The Steam Community Market works as the primary platform for purchasing and selling CS2 products, with prices changing based upon demand, rarity, and the introduction of brand-new cases and skins.
